PhumU2
The Pediculus humanus USDA strain was sequenced to 8.5x shotgun coverage and assembled by the J. Craig Venter Institute (JCVI). The assembly presented here (PhumU2, 2014) consists of 1,900 supercontigs totalling 110 Mb with a scaffold N50 of 497 kb.
Pediculus humanus is also unusual in that it possesses 18 mitochondrial minichromosomes (sequences FJ499473-FJ499490) as detaled in the publication "The single mitochondrial chromosome typical of animals has evolved into 18 minichromosomes in the human body louse, Pediculus humanus" by Shao et al, Genome Research, 2008.
